Redefining Accessibility: From Downloads to Instant Engagement
Historically, many digital platforms relied on downloadable applications to deliver full functionality—think of early language learning platforms, productivity tools, or creative suites. However, this approach posed barriers: lengthy downloads, device compatibility issues, memory constraints, and update management hampered seamless user experiences. As industry standards evolved, so did the expectations of users who sought instant, hassle-free access.
Today, the paradigm is shifting towards browser-based applications that maintain high performance without the need for installation. This transition is driven by advancements in web technologies like HTML5, WebAssembly, and progressive web apps (PWAs), which enable complex functionalities directly within the browser environment. This is especially vital in accessibility, where instant, frictionless access can significantly improve engagement for users with diverse needs.

The Future Outlook: Blurring Boundaries Between Web and Native Apps
As web technologies continue to advance, the distinction between native and web applications narrows, opening new avenues for accessible and intuitive digital experiences. Progressive Web Apps (PWAs), in particular, promise the best of both worlds—instant accessibility, offline support, and robust performance.
